Output b438949e836e81bf34af4e5560981ebe3e342d5ff063f889515247d1e92ffb3e:44

value
1594980
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64afc12b7fc925d36126ecf1bf39d6c2bb731b57de234298ed5267ec5ba66dbf
address
tb1pvjhuz2mleyjaxcfxancm7wwkc2ahxx6hmc359x8d2fn7ckaxdkls44w0fy
transaction
b438949e836e81bf34af4e5560981ebe3e342d5ff063f889515247d1e92ffb3e
confirmations
5554
spent
false

3 Sat Ranges